The trouble is that there are no official high quality sources for the theatrical mixes for us to experience. Everything is a recreation, conversion, optical capture or early LD release and is the best we can manage.

If you could playback a direct version of the original 4 track master nothing would surpass it. This is the source sound negative mix that the 70mm and stereo would have been made from. Going to the printmasters for each would be the best option for the specific mixes if the actual source was unavailable. It has been alluded to that LFL has every mix perfectly archived and is how so many mono mix elements made it into the 97SE mix.

The 93 mix was an attempt to beef up the tracks for home audio but it must always be understood that they were made with the home cinema format limitations of 1993 in mind.
